Error detecting in inductive inference

1995
Several well-known inductive inference strategies change the actual hypothesis only when they discover that it “provably misclassifies” an example seen so far. This notion is made mathematically precise and its general power is characterized. In spite of its strength it is shown that this approach is not of universal power.

Optimal codes for error detection

IEEE Transactions on Information Theory, 1992
Summary: The probability of undetected error for codes over \(GF(2^ m)\) having a generator matrix over \(GF(2)\) is studied. The optimal codes of dimensions four or less are determined. For higher dimensions, we determine some properties of optimal codes.

Error detection and correction for memories

Microprocessors, 1978
Abstract The economic advantages offered by increased packing densities of semiconductor storage devices have been partially offset by doubts over their reliability. However, it is shown that a reliability improvement of 70–80% can be achieved by using relatively simple error detection circuits.
